2001 Chevy Tracker Changing gears

Transmission problem
2001 Chevy Tracker Automatic 95000 miles

When moving from one gear to another (Park to Reverse/Reverse to Drive) the slots feel mushy and the gear shift does not click into place...now everything from Reverse down is basically neutral...what is wrong with it and how much is this going to cost?

well it sounds like the problem is your Shifting cable. If it is you shifting cable then it is streched out. It shouldn't cost that much maybe like 40-50 dollars. Just buy a new one and look up for to change it.
